Mark Hindsbo leads Operations Software at Siemens Digital Industries, focusing on merging the digital and real worlds for manufacturers. His career includes leadership roles at Ansys, Microsoft, and The Boston Consulting Group. Colleagues describe him as an inspiring, transparent, and visionary leader with deep technology and market knowledge. He holds an M. S. from the Technical University of Denmark.
Outside of work, Mark is a lifelong martial artist with a 5th-degree black belt in Karate, applying its principles of discipline and focus to his professional life. He maintains a passion for coding that began with 8/16-bit computers and has developed retro-style video games for the Commodore 64. He also enjoys reading.
He is also an Adjunct Professor at Carnegie Mellon University, where he teaches a course on applying AI and machine learning in industrial applications.
